Coarse Graining, Fixed Points, and Scaling in a Large Population of Neurons (2019)

Leenoy Meshulam, Jeffrey L. Gauthier, Carlos D. Brody, David W. Tank, William Bialek. Physical Review Letters (2019) (Physical Review Letters) (local cache)

Abstract

We develop a phenomenological coarse-graining procedure for activity in a large network of neurons, and apply this to recordings from a population of 1000+ cells in the hippocampus. Distributions of coarse-grained variables seem to approach a fixed non-Gaussian form, and we see evidence of scaling in both static and dynamic quantities. These results suggest that the collective behavior of the network is described by a nontrivial fixed point.
